Here is a "…polished and impressive Cabernet" (WinePilot) to savour from WA's Great Southern, and 5 Star-rated Plantagenet, with a raft of high scores up to 94pts.
Sam Kim Wine Orbit loves its:"… concentrated palate that offers outstanding depth and focus together with refined mouthfeel", also calling it "magnificently styled".
"Blackcurrant, bay leaf and granite aromatics. Tightly wound, black and red fruits on entry with graphite and dried herb notes running into the core. Tannins are gravelly and taut, a hint of acid lifts the middle and it all carries to a long finish. 93pts (Stuart Knox, The Real Review).
For Ken Gargett, WinePilot: "Deep dark secrets are lurking in this polished and impressive Cabernet… Dark chocolate, blackcurrant and black olive all find their way into a complex aromatic mix. Tannins are firm and ripe, adding structure to the core, while the oak has been lapped up by the powerful fruit intensity. 93pts."
